Description
Astro the Alien and his friends Ben and Eva go camping in the desert. On their hike, they learn about many desert animals, including lizards, birds, and spiders. Includes reading activities and a word list.

A Note From the Publisher
Meet Astro the Alien! Astro landed on earth and now lives in Ben and Eva’s backyard in a space pod. Together they take fun trips so that Astro can learn more about the world he now lives in! Written at a slightly higher level than the introductory Dear Dragon series, Astro the Alien books help early readers build on previous skills; expanding vocabulary and learning more complex concepts. Readers will have fun as they go along on adventures with Astro, Ben and Eva to learn interesting things about science, geography and history! Each book includes a note to caregivers and activities to promote reading success.

The Astro the Alien series is a Beginning to Read Book published by Norwood Press. I like this series as it is simple to read and filled with a lot of activities and suggestions at the end to help children develop both reading recognition skills and comprehension skills. In this book Astro and his friends Ben and Eva fly to the dessert in Astro's space pod. They bring their camping gear and spend a night. They get to see animals in the day and those that come out at night. They also talk about climate and how it effects the dessert and animals. The illustrations were well done. They are bright, colourful and large so you can see the animals clearly. A good book for a family library and primary classroom.
